Best Months to Buy a New Car in UAE for Discounts

UAE dealers offer biggest discounts in DSF, Ramadan, end-of-year clearance. Here are the months that consistently save AED 10K-30K in 2026.

Quick answer

In 2026, the months offering the largest discounts on new cars in the UAE are December, April (Ramadan), and January. Dealers typically cut AED 10,000–30,000 off listed prices during Dubai Shopping Festival, Ramadan, and end-of-year stock clearance. These periods coincide with lower sales volumes and dealers needing to meet annual targets. Avoid March, June, and September when margins are tightest.

December: End-of-year stock clearance

Most authorised dealers run aggressive promotions between 1–31 December. They must hit annual sales targets set by manufacturers such as Toyota, Hyundai, and BMW. In 2026, expect cash discounts of AED 15,000–25,000 on popular models including Toyota Camry, Hyundai Tucson, and BMW 3 Series. Some dealers also offer free servicing packages worth AED 4,000–7,000 or interest-free finance for 36 months through banks such as Emirates NBD or FAB.

Key dates and targets

Dealers usually announce promotions around 10–15 December after November sales figures are known. Apply for finance approval before 20 December to lock in rates. Finance companies review budgets after 25 December, so last-minute deals may lose ground.

Models showing largest cuts

Overstocked inventory from 2025 carry-over units triggers extra discounts. Carry-over 2025 Toyota Land Cruiser models may drop by AED 25,000–30,000. 2026 model year Toyota Fortuner and Hyundai Santa Fe will see smaller cuts of AED 8,000–12,000.

April: Ramadan discounts

Ramadan 2026 runs approximately 1–30 April. Dealers reduce prices during the fasting month because showroom traffic drops 30–40 %. Discounts range from AED 12,000–22,000 on mid-size SUVs and family saloons. Many dealers combine price cuts with deferred payment plans until Eid al-Fitr.

Practical steps during Ramadan

Visit showrooms after iftar (around 7:00 pm) when staff have more time. Submit documents online via dealer apps such as Al Tayer, Al Fahad, and Al Futtaim before 10:00 pm to avoid long queues. Online configurators give real-time discount codes that can be used at any branch.

Models commonly discounted

Al Tayer Motors offers AED 18,000–22,000 off Toyota RAV4 and Camry. Al Fahad Auto reduces Hyundai Creta and Tucson by AED 15,000–18,000. Al Futtaim offers extra 2–3 months free servicing on Ford models.

Months to avoid

High-margin months include March, June, and September. March contains National Day holiday prep, June is peak summer travel season, and September is school year start. In these months, dealers rarely offer discounts beyond AED 3,000–5,000 because sales volumes stay relatively high.

Comparison of 2026 discount periods

December offers the largest absolute cuts but competition for deals is intense. April Ramadan discounts are quieter but finance options are deferred. January deals are easier to negotiate because remaining inventory is clearer.

FAQs

How much can I actually save in December 2026?

Typical range is AED 15,000–25,000 on mid-size models. Premium German brands show 10–15 % off MSRP when combined with finance offers.

Can I negotiate further during Ramadan?

Yes. After iftar, staff shortages create leverage. Bring competing dealer offers and ask for free servicing or window tinting.

Are January 2026 deals genuine or just old inventory?

January deals include both carry-over 2025 models and leftover 2026 model-year units that dealers must move before February plate changes.

Does Dubai Shopping Festival help car discounts?

DSF runs January–February 2026. It extends January discounts and adds draw prizes such free insurance and extended warranties.

Does licence fee change affect timing?

2026 RTA licence fees remain unchanged at AED 1,200–1,500 per year for private passenger cars. Timing discounts does not affect registration fees.
